1. What is Iron Saturation?

Iron saturation, also called transferrin saturation, is a medical laboratory value that measures the percentage of iron-binding sites on transferrin that are occupied by iron. It's an important indicator of iron status in the body.

2. How Does the Calculator Work?

The calculator uses the iron saturation formula:

\[ \text{Saturation} = \frac{\text{Iron}}{\text{TIBC}} \times 100 \]

Where:

Explanation: The equation calculates what percentage of available iron-binding sites are actually occupied by iron.

3. Importance of Iron Saturation

Details: Iron saturation helps diagnose iron deficiency or iron overload conditions. Low saturation suggests iron deficiency, while high saturation may indicate hemochromatosis or iron overload.

5. Frequently Asked Questions (FAQ)

Q1: What are normal iron saturation values?
A: Normal range is typically 20-50%. Values below 20% may indicate iron deficiency, while above 50% may suggest iron overload.

Q2: How does this differ from serum ferritin?
A: Ferritin measures iron stores, while saturation reflects current iron availability for use.

Q3: When should iron studies be performed?
A: When evaluating anemia, suspected iron deficiency, or possible hemochromatosis.

Q4: Are there limitations to iron saturation?
A: Results can be affected by inflammation, liver disease, or recent iron intake.

Q5: What is UIBC and how does it relate?
A: UIBC (unsaturated iron-binding capacity) is TIBC minus serum iron, and can also be used to calculate saturation.
